tree:   https://github.com/0day-ci/linux/commits/UPDATE-20191227-152331/Rocky-Liao/Bluetooth-hci_qca-Add-QCA-Rome-power-off-support-to-the-qca_power_off/20191226-050402
head:   09bd19eeb033b7c6f884736777cbddeb1119625b
commit: 09bd19eeb033b7c6f884736777cbddeb1119625b [4/4] Bluetooth: hci_qca: Add HCI command timeout handling
config: i386-allyesconfig (attached as .config)
compiler: gcc-7 (Debian 7.5.0-3) 7.5.0
reproduce:
        git checkout 09bd19eeb033b7c6f884736777cbddeb1119625b
        # save the attached .config to linux build tree
        make ARCH=i386 

If you fix the issue, kindly add following tag
Reported-by: kbuild test robot <lkp@intel.com>

All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):

   dr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c: In function 'qca_setup':
>> dr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c:1346:21: error: assignment from incompatible pointer type [-Werror=incompatible-pointer-types]
      hdev->cmd_timeout = qca_cmd_timeout;
                        ^
>> dr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c:1347:6: error: 'struct qca_data' has no member named 'cmd_timeout_cnt'
      qca->cmd_timeout_cnt = 0;
         ^~
   In file included from dr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c:33:0:
   dr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c: In function 'qca_cmd_timeout':
   dr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c:1504:54: error: 'struct qca_data' has no member named 'cmd_timeout_cnt'
     BT_ERR("hu %p hci cmd timeout count=0x%x", hu, ++qca->cmd_timeout_cnt);
                                                         ^
   include/net/bluetooth/bluetooth.h:138:45: note: in definition of macro 'BT_ERR'
    #define BT_ERR(fmt, ...) bt_err(fmt "\n", ##__VA_ARGS__)
                                                ^~~~~~~~~~~
   dr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c:1506:9: error: 'struct qca_data' has no member named 'cmd_timeout_cnt'
     if (qca->cmd_timeout_cnt >= QCA_MAX_CMD_TIMEOUT_COUNT)
            ^~
   cc1: some warnings being treated as errors

vim +1346 drivers/bluetooth/hci_qca.c

  1264	
  1265	static int qca_setup(struct hci_uart *hu)
  1266	{
  1267		struct hci_dev *hdev = hu->hdev;
  1268		struct qca_data *qca = hu->priv;
  1269		struct qca_serdev *qcadev;
  1270		unsigned int speed, qca_baudrate = QCA_BAUDRATE_115200;
  1271		unsigned int init_retry_count = 0;
  1272		enum qca_btsoc_type soc_type = qca_soc_type(hu);
  1273		const char *firmware_name = qca_get_firmware_name(hu);
  1274		int ret;
  1275		int soc_ver = 0;
  1276	
  1277		ret = qca_check_speeds(hu);
  1278		if (ret)
  1279			return ret;
  1280	
  1281		/* Patch downloading has to be done without IBS mode */
  1282		clear_bit(QCA_IBS_ENABLED, &qca->flags);
  1283	
  1284		/* Enable controller to do both LE scan and BR/EDR inquiry
  1285		 * simultaneously.
  1286		 */
  1287		set_bit(HCI_QUIRK_SIMULTANEOUS_DISCOVERY, &hdev->quirks);
  1288	
  1289	retry:
  1290		if (qca_is_wcn399x(soc_type)) {
  1291			bt_dev_info(hdev, "setting up wcn3990");
  1292	
  1293			/* Enable NON_PERSISTENT_SETUP QUIRK to ensure to execute
  1294			 * setup for every hci up.
  1295			 */
  1296			set_bit(HCI_QUIRK_NON_PERSISTENT_SETUP, &hdev->quirks);
  1297			set_bit(HCI_QUIRK_USE_BDADDR_PROPERTY, &hdev->quirks);
  1298			hu->hdev->shutdown = qca_power_off;
  1299			ret = qca_wcn3990_init(hu);
  1300			if (ret)
  1301				return ret;
  1302	
  1303			ret = qca_read_soc_version(hdev, &soc_ver, soc_type);
  1304			if (ret)
  1305				return ret;
  1306		} else {
  1307			bt_dev_info(hdev, "ROME setup");
  1308			if (hu->serdev) {
  1309				/* Enable NON_PERSISTENT_SETUP QUIRK to ensure to
  1310				 * execute setup for every hci up.
  1311				 */
  1312				set_bit(HCI_QUIRK_NON_PERSISTENT_SETUP, &hdev->quirks);
  1313				hu->hdev->shutdown = qca_power_off;
  1314				qcadev = serdev_device_get_drvdata(hu->serdev);
  1315				gpiod_set_value_cansleep(qcadev->bt_en, 1);
  1316				/* Controller needs time to bootup. */
  1317				msleep(150);
  1318			}
  1319			qca_set_speed(hu, QCA_INIT_SPEED);
  1320		}
  1321	
  1322		/* Setup user speed if needed */
  1323		speed = qca_get_speed(hu, QCA_OPER_SPEED);
  1324		if (speed) {
  1325			ret = qca_set_speed(hu, QCA_OPER_SPEED);
  1326			if (ret)
  1327				return ret;
  1328	
  1329			qca_baudrate = qca_get_baudrate_value(speed);
  1330		}
  1331	
  1332		if (!qca_is_wcn399x(soc_type)) {
  1333			/* Get QCA version information */
  1334			ret = qca_read_soc_version(hdev, &soc_ver, soc_type);
  1335			if (ret)
  1336				return ret;
  1337		}
  1338	
  1339		bt_dev_info(hdev, "QCA controller version 0x%08x", soc_ver);
  1340		/* Setup patch / NVM configurations */
  1341		ret = qca_uart_setup(hdev, qca_baudrate, soc_type, soc_ver,
  1342				firmware_name);
  1343		if (!ret) {
  1344			set_bit(QCA_IBS_ENABLED, &qca->flags);
  1345			qca_debugfs_init(hdev);
> 1346			hdev->cmd_timeout = qca_cmd_timeout;
> 1347			qca->cmd_timeout_cnt = 0;
  1348		} else if (ret == -ENOENT) {
  1349			/* No patch/nvm-config found, run with original fw/config */
  1350			ret = 0;
  1351		} else if (ret == -EAGAIN) {
  1352			/*
  1353			 * Userspace firmware loader will return -EAGAIN in case no
  1354			 * patch/nvm-config is found, so run with original fw/config.
  1355			 */
  1356			ret = 0;
  1357		} else {
  1358			if (init_retry_count < QCA_MAX_INIT_RETRY_COUNT) {
  1359				qca_power_off(hdev);
  1360				if (hu->serdev) {
  1361					serdev_device_close(hu->serdev);
  1362					ret = serdev_device_open(hu->serdev);
  1363					if (ret) {
  1364						bt_dev_err(hu->hdev, "open port fail");
  1365						return ret;
  1366					}
  1367				}
  1368				init_retry_count++;
  1369				goto retry;
  1370			}
  1371		}
  1372	
  1373		/* Setup bdaddr */
  1374		if (qca_is_wcn399x(soc_type))
  1375			hu->hdev->set_bdaddr = qca_set_bdaddr;
  1376		else
  1377			hu->hdev->set_bdaddr = qca_set_bdaddr_rome;
  1378	
  1379		return ret;
  1380	}
